The trade deadline came and went with the Patriots acquiring just one player, WR Isaiah Ford from Miami. Isaiah Mack was also claimed to help build up the defensive front ranks. Donte Moncreif and Ryan Glasgow are interesting adds to the PS, I could see both of them getting activated on game days if they stick around.

Devin Asiasi will miss at least three games as he was placed on IR, this now raises some questions about the TE position in general, Dalton Keene and Ryan Izzo are still banged up also.

16 Players are questionable to play for the Patriots, including starters Stephon Gilmore, Shaq Mason, Joe Thuney, Nick Folk, Lawrence Guy, Deatrich Wise, and more. Here’s hoping everyone can rest up and be good to go, but I wouldn’t be surprised if a few miss out, especially the likes of Guy and Wise, both of who are suffering from multiple ailments.

The Jets look set to rely on the services of veteran QB Joe Flacco on Monday night as Sam Darnold is doubtful to play with a shoulder injury. Also doubtful is their 3rd pick from this year’s draft Quinnen Williams, who would be a huge loss for the Jets defense.

Cam Tests Positive

According to reports, Newton was informed about his positive test late Friday night and went straight into self-quarantine. The team had players at the facility yesterday who were then sent home when optimism to play as scheduled on Sunday faded.

The Chiefs had their own problems with the virus as practice squad QB Jordan Ta’amu also had a positive test. As of right now, no other Patriots or Chiefs players/staff members have tested positive.

With the news coming in yesterday that David Andrews and Josh Uche had been placed on IR, a couple of inevitable PS promotions have taken place. Firstly James Ferentz was signed to the 53-man roster instead of being promoted, which means he won’t automatically revert back to the PS after today’s game. Ferentz along with Hjalte Froholdt are candidates to start at center in the absence of Andrews, although, don’t be surprised if there is some movement across the whole offensive front.

Nick Thurman is called up to the main roster for the second-straight week and UDFA Isaiah Zuber also gets the nod, hopefully this isn’t an indication that Edelman or Harry can’t play.

Folk was signed to the team’s main roster after last week’s win against Miami, I thought we could potentially see a new face in as kicker, but Folk will get to continue his role for now. UDFA Myles Bryant is on the team! Now, given the depth already at the CB position, Bryant will have to be patient, but I like the kid and I think he can contribute in time.

Nick Thurman also gets an opportunity to support, his promotion to the main roster will give some extra depth for the defensive line.
